Centaurus Metals (ASX:CTM) said process flowsheet refinement at its Jaguar nickel sulfide project in Brazil delivered over 30 kilograms of high-grade concentrate grading 34% nickel in a pilot plant trial, according to a Tuesday Australian bourse filing.
The flowsheet refinement is part of the Jaguar value engineering process, which is meant to produce a high-grade nickel concentrate with low impurities.
It is evaluating the capital and operating cost impacts of the revised process flowsheet, as well as whether any amendments are required to the environmental approval process.
Its shares rose 6% in trading on Tuesday.
